  • Publication number: 20040019927
    Abstract: The invention relates to plant transcription factor polypeptides, polynucleotides that encode them, homologs from a variety of plant species, and methods of using the polynucleotides and polypeptides to produce transgenic plants having advantageous properties compared to a reference plant. Sequence information related to these polynucleotides and polypeptides can also be used in bioinformatic search methods and is also disclosed.
    Type: Application
    Filed: February 25, 2003
    Publication date: January 29, 2004
    Inventors: Bradley K. Sherman, Jose Luis Riechmann, Cai-Zhong Jiang, Jacqueline E. Heard, Volker Haake, Robert A. Creelman, Oliver Ratcliffe, Luc J. Adam, T. Lynne Reuber, James Keddie, Pierre E. Broun, Marsha L. Pilgrim, Arnold N. DuBell, Omaira Pineda, Guo-Liang Yu
